Decoration only question
Does changing an object to decoration only actually help if the physics for that object is not on anyways? Getting too many physic objects message In Areas that are far less complex than other areas with no warnings. Also I have an area with six pistons running that lags but. I warnings and do t want to delete pistons. Right next to this area I have 11physics objects with joints and they operate fine..please any advice?

Re: Decoration only question
I'm pretty sure it does help, but I don't know how much exactly. Consider that for each physical object in your track, the game needs to figure out what other physical objects might come into contact with it. Even if the object is off the driving line, the game will need to do extra calculations for it, in case some stray piece of wood should happen to fly through the air and strike it.

Re: Decoration only question
I saw a developer post in another thread a few days ago which said the decoration only setting helps with frame rate issues where the game lags. It has zero impact on the overall complexity meter of a track. Now, as far as the physic object warning, I am dealing with the same thing on a track I'm building. I have set everything not on the driving line to deco, and areas with physics have no warnings and areas with no physics are lagged and flashing the red text like crazy.
